Frank Rowland (1927–2012) was an American artist, master printer, and designer known for his work in painting, printmaking, illustration, photography, and industrial design. Born in Altoona, Pennsylvania, he studied art in Pittsburgh and Chicago before building a diverse career that included architecture, film set design, museum exhibitions, and commercial art. Rowland was especially recognized for his expertise in fine-art serigraphy (silkscreen printing), producing prints for prominent artists while also creating his own abstract and geometric works. His art is noted for its bold use of color, form, and visual experimentation.
